Casa María, St. Mary’s blessed with snow

February 4, 2011

A light dusting of snow sprinkled the campus in the early hours of the morning on Friday, Feb. 4, prompting the university to close for the day.

We awoke to find our campus blessed with snow—a unique sign of God’s blessing that makes a rare appearance in San Antonio; old-timers (such as our brothers from the Marianist residence at the north side of campus) say that this is the first time since 1984 that snow has accumulated  on the ground.

Casa Tuesday celebrates Chinese new year

February 1, 2011

This slideshow requires JavaScript.

A happy hare hopped on by to Casa Maria where more than 40 students, staff, Marianists and guests, some of whom wore the auspicious color of red, welcomed the Year of the Rabbit during an Asian Lunar New Year-inspired celebration.

This week’s menu included stir-fried rice, spring rolls, Mandarin oranges, Chinese almond cookies and fortune cookies. Bright red bookmarks with a blessing from Casa Maria were distributed with the opportunity for guests to stamp them with Chinese characters, such as “love,” “peace,” “truth,” “forgiveness” and “friend.” Happy new year—again!

Casa Tuesday kicks off Marianist Heritage week

January 18, 2011

This slideshow requires JavaScript.

Casa Tuesday kicked off Marianist Heritage week with an evening prayer that recounted the beginnings of the Marianist Family in post-revolutionary war France, the Marianist doxology sung in English-Spanish-Hawaiian, Tex-Mex style chili dogs and an assortment of international cookies from Malaysia, Poland, Germany, France and Croatia.
